Population Overview

Woodville is a small community located in Mississippi, within Wilkinson County. The total population is 1,037. It ranks as the 192nd most populous out of 420 Census-designated places in Mississippi.

Age Demographics

The median age in Woodville is 50.0 years. This is 30% higher than the state median of 38.6 years.

Economy, Income & Housing

The median household income in Woodville is $52,894. This is 6% lower than the state median of $56,447. It is also 34% lower than the national median of $80,734. The poverty rate stands at 8.4%. This is 56% lower than the state poverty rate of 18.9%. The unemployment rate is 17.6%. This is 205% higher than the state rate of 5.8%. The median home value is $109,200. Housing costs are 36% lower than the state median of $169,800. With a home-value-to-income ratio of just 2.1x, Woodville is one of the most affordable housing markets in the area. 77.1% of occupied housing units are owner-occupied. This homeownership rate is 10% higher than the state average of 70.0%.

Race & Ethnicity

The largest racial or ethnic group in Woodville is Black or African American, making up 71.2% of the population. White (non-Hispanic) residents account for 23.3%. The White (non-Hispanic) population (23.3%) is well below the state average of 55.2%. The Black or African American population is significantly higher than the state average (71.2% vs 36.3%). The Hispanic or Latino population (1.4%) is well below the state average of 3.7%.

Education

16.9% of residents aged 25 and older hold a bachelor's degree or higher. This is 33% lower than the state rate of 25.1%. Nationally, 35.7% of adults hold at least a bachelor's degree. The high school graduation rate (or equivalent) is 91.3%.
